Delninių kompiuterių programinės įrangos projektavimo metodų tyrimas / Pocket PC software analysis of designing methods

While there has been much successful work in developing rules to guide the design and implementation of interfaces for desktop machines and their applications, the design of mobile device interfaces is still relatively unexplored and unproven. This paper discusses the characteristics and limitations of current mobile device interfaces. Using existing interface guidelines as a starting point, a set of practical design guidelines for mobile device interfaces is proposed. An experimental interface was created that ran on a Pocket PC 2002 mobile computer and used a simple events registration style interface to enter data of basketball’s competition. The buttons of the registration system were changed in size between 12x12, 16x16 and 20x20 pixels and used a sound. Results showed that sounds significantly improved usability for both standard and small buttons.
